This commit is contained in:
Rao 2025-03-02 21:29:19 +08:00
parent 5c42a2608d
commit 9c6d3ba51e
1 changed files with 8 additions and 5 deletions

View File

@ -39,12 +39,15 @@ const NodeMenu: React.FC<NodeMenuProps> = ({ mind }) => {
); );
useEffect(() => { useEffect(() => {
{ {
if (urlMode === "POSTURL" && lecture?.courseId && lecture?.id) if(lecture?.courseId && lecture?.id){
if (urlMode === "POSTURL"){
setUrl(`/course/${lecture?.courseId}/detail/${lecture?.id}`); setUrl(`/course/${lecture?.courseId}/detail/${lecture?.id}`);
}
mind.reshapeNode(mind.currentNode, { mind.reshapeNode(mind.currentNode, {
hyperLink: `/course/${lecture?.courseId}/detail/${lecture?.id}`, hyperLink: `/course/${lecture?.courseId}/detail/${lecture?.id}`,
}); });
} }
}
}, [postId, lecture, isLoading, urlMode]); }, [postId, lecture, isLoading, urlMode]);
//监听思维导图节点选择事件,更新节点菜单状态 //监听思维导图节点选择事件,更新节点菜单状态